In a move that would boost tourism in Mizoram’s Champhai district, the district has been selected to be develop as a sustainable and responsible destination under Swadesh Darshan 2.

Champhai is known for its rich culture and heritage, adventure, and ecotourism. Some of the important destinations in Champhai include Lianchhiari Lunglen Tlang, Mizo Hlakungpui Mual, Kawtchhuah Ropui, Thasiama SeNo neihna, Kungawrhi Puk, and Lamsial Puk.

The Swadesh Darshan Scheme (SDS) was launched by the center in 2014-15 for the integrated development of theme-based tourist circuits in the country with the objective of developing tourism infrastructure.

A total of 76 projects have been sanctioned in various states and the UT administration under this scheme.

In January this year, the Ministry of Tourism revamped its Swadesh Darshan scheme as Swadesh Darshan 2.0 (SD2.0) for the development of sustainable and responsible tourist destinations.
The objective of the Swadesh Darshan 2.0 scheme is to increase private sector investment in tourism and hospitality.

This scheme will help increase public-private partnerships (PPP) in the field of tourism and the operation and maintenance of the assets created under the scheme.

Under the scheme, over 30 cities from across 15 states are being shortlisted to be developed as sustainable and responsible destinations.

In Northeast, Assam’s Kokrajhar district, a popular wildlife tourist circuit with national parks like Manas National Park, Raimona National Park, and religious places like Mahamaya Dham and Mahamaya Snan Ghat will be taken up for overall development and upgradation.

Jorhat, another popular wildlife tourist destination in the state, will showcase Kaziranga National Park, Gibbon Wildlife Sanctuary, Majuli, and Shivsagar known for its rich culture and heritage.
